Output ec0ab40d797d94decb1fd624718cf389b87db3757b74202d16bc286f225e6672:3

value
264457
script pubkey
OP_0 OP_PUSHBYTES_20 88b510338162825f0f95fdb95dc2353c8cc24e6a
address
tb1q3z63qvupv2p97ru4lku4ms348jxvynn2pweug8
transaction
ec0ab40d797d94decb1fd624718cf389b87db3757b74202d16bc286f225e6672